Overview
71024S12YGI8 from Renesas Electronics is a 128K × 8-bit high-speed CMOS static RAM with 12 ns access time, industrial temperature range (–40°C to +85°C), single 5V supply operation, TTL-compatible I/O, and dual chip select plus output enable control. It serves as fast, fully static main or cache memory in embedded controllers and real-time data acquisition systems.
For engineers reviewing the 71024S12YGI8 datasheet, 71024S12YGI8 pinout, 71024S12YGI8 application, or 71024S12YGI8 equivalent, key selection criteria include guaranteed 12 ns read cycle time, industrial-grade reliability, SOJ-32 package compatibility, low standby current (10 mA ISB1), and direct TTL-level interfacing without level shifters.
Technical Context
The 71024S12YGI8 implements fully asynchronous static RAM architecture with no clocks or refresh required. Its dual CS inputs (CS1 active-low, CS2 active-high) and independent OE pin enable flexible memory banking and interleaved access control in multi-master bus systems.
All 8 bidirectional I/O lines operate at TTL voltage levels (VIH ≥ 2.2 V, VIL ≤ 0.8 V) with 5 V supply, and internal circuitry ensures tCLZ ≤ 3 ns and tOHZ ≤ 5 ns for fast bus turnaround-critical for high-throughput microprocessor co-processor interfaces.

Pinout & Package
71024S12YGI8 is housed in a 32-pin Plastic SOJ (Small Outline J-Lead) package with 400-mil body width (PBG32), designed for reflow soldering and board-level reliability in industrial environments.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| A0–A16 | Address Inputs | 17-bit address bus supporting full 128K decoding; A16 is MSB |
| I/O0–I/O7 | Bidirectional Data Lines | 8-bit parallel data path; direction controlled by WE and CS states |
| CS1, CS2 | Chip Select Inputs | CS1 active-low, CS2 active-high - enables hierarchical memory mapping with two independent enables |
| OE | Output Enable | Active-low control of output drivers; allows shared bus arbitration without tristate conflicts |
| WE | Write Enable | Active-low signal initiating write cycle; timing-critical for tWP ≥ 8 ns compliance |
| VCC, GND | Power Supply | Single 5V supply with dedicated ground pin; decoupling required per JEDEC SOJ guidelines |

FAQ
What is the maximum guaranteed access time for the 71024S12YGI8?
The 71024S12YGI8 has a maximum guaranteed address access time (tAA) of 12 ns across its full industrial temperature range (–40°C to +85°C) and supply voltage range (4.5 V to 5.5 V). This specification is production-tested and applies to all valid address transitions under standard TTL loading conditions, making it suitable for systems requiring deterministic sub-83 MHz memory interface timing.
Does the 71024S12YGI8 require a refresh circuit or clock signal?
No, the 71024S12YGI8 is a fully static RAM and requires no refresh cycles or clock input. Its internal CMOS latching circuitry maintains data indefinitely as long as power is applied and address/control signals remain stable. This eliminates refresh overhead and timing uncertainty, simplifying system design for real-time applications such as industrial control and data acquisition where deterministic latency is critical. The 71024S12YGI8 operates entirely asynchronously.
What package type and pin count does the 71024S12YGI8 use?
The 71024S12YGI8 uses a 32-pin Plastic SOJ (Small Outline J-Lead) package with 400-mil body width, designated PBG32 in Renesas' ordering nomenclature. This JEDEC-standard surface-mount package features gull-wing leads optimized for reflow soldering and mechanical robustness in industrial environments. Pin count and spacing match industry-standard 32-pin SOJ footprints, enabling direct PCB compatibility with legacy designs using similar SRAMs.
Can the 71024S12YGI8 interface directly with a 5V microcontroller without level shifters?
Yes, the 71024S12YGI8 features fully TTL-compatible inputs and outputs operating from a single 5V supply (4.5 V to 5.5 V), with VIH minimum of 2.2 V and VIL maximum of 0.8 V. Its I/O pins drive and accept standard 5V TTL logic levels directly, eliminating the need for external level-shifting circuitry when interfacing with legacy 5V microcontrollers such as the Intel 80C186, Motorola 68EC000, or FPGA I/O banks configured for 5V tolerance. This is confirmed in the DC Electrical Characteristics table of the official datasheet.
